Title :
The direct breakdown voltage of silicone oil under uniform fields

Abstract :
The breakdown voltage versus gap length characteristics were obtained for degassed silicone oil, oil saturated with oxygen and oil containing varying concentrations of 1-methylnaphthalene as additive. Both aluminium and stainless steel electrodes were used. The breakdown voltage - gap characteristics for various additive concentrations in degassed oil all pass through a critical gap length at which the breakdown voltage is independent of the additive concentration. For gaps longer than the critical gap the breakdown voltage decreases with increasing additive concentration. For oil saturated with oxygen no such critical gap is present.
